Kinds Of Replacement Windows
Selecting the best type of window for replacement is important. Property owners ought to think about elements such as product, style, and energy efficiency. Below are popular types of replacement windows:
| Window Type | Description | Pros | Cons |
|---|---|---|---|
| Vinyl Windows | Made from long lasting and energy-efficient PVC material. | Low maintenance, energy-efficient, and affordable. | Restricted color alternatives and may not be as long lasting as wood. |
| Wood Windows | Timeless choice, understood for appeal and excellent insulation. | Aesthetic appeal, excellent insulators, and personalized. | High upkeep and susceptible to rot and pests. |
| Aluminum Windows | Made from strong, lightweight aluminum frames. | Resilient, low maintenance, and ideal for modern-day designs. | Poor insulation and can be loud. |
| Fiberglass Windows | Made from a composite material that simulates the appearance of wood. | Exceptional energy performance, resilient, and provides high insulation. | Typically more costly than wood or vinyl alternatives. |
| Composite Windows | Integrates materials to use the very best of both worlds. | Excellent insulation, resilience, and low upkeep. | Can be expensive depending on the brand and style. |

Costs of Window Replacement
The expense of window replacement can differ widely based on a number of aspects, consisting of the type of window, size, design, and the complexity of the installation. Below is a table that details the average expenses related to typical types of windows:
| Window Type | Typical Cost (per window) | Notes |
|---|---|---|
| Vinyl Windows | ₤ 300 - ₤ 700 | Cost-efficient and fairly easy to install. |
| Wood Windows | ₤ 500 - ₤ 1,200 | More attractive aesthetically but includes greater upkeep costs. |
| Aluminum Windows | ₤ 300 - ₤ 800 | Good for modern visual appeals but might require extra insulation. |
| Fiberglass Windows | ₤ 600 - ₤ 1,500 | Greater in advance expense but provides outstanding energy performance. |
| Composite Windows | ₤ 500 - ₤ 1,200 | Provides a balance of looks and functionality. |
It's essential for house owners to acquire multiple quotes from various providers to make a notified decision based on their spending plan.
FAQs about Home Window Replacement
1. How do Residential Window Repair understand if I need brand-new windows?
Signs that you might require brand-new windows include drafts, difficulty opening or closing, condensation between the panes, and noticeable damage or rot.
2. Can I set up replacement windows myself?
While DIY installation is possible, it is extremely recommended to employ specialists due to the intricacy of the installation procedure and to ensure energy efficiency and correct insulation.
3. How long do replacement windows last?
Typically, replacement windows can last anywhere from 15 to 50 years, depending upon the material and upkeep.
4. Are energy-efficient windows worth the investment?
Yes, energy-efficient windows can significantly lower your energy costs gradually and enhance the comfort of your home, making them a worthwhile investment.
5. What is the best time of year to replace windows?
Spring and fall are typically thought about the very best times for window replacement, as the weather contributes to installation without extreme temperature impacts.
